Ingredients for Low Cal Iced Coffee With Milk Cafe Au Lait
- Instant Coffee
- Optional: ½ cup (120ml) cold water (to adjust coffee strength)
- Low Fat Milk
- Splenda Sugar Substitute
- ¼ teaspoon ground cinnamon
- ½ teaspoon vanilla extract
- Ice Cube

How to Make Low Cal Iced Coffee With Milk Cafe Au Lait
- Brew 1 cup (240ml) of strong coffee. Allow to cool completely, or chill in the refrigerator for at least 30 minutes.
- If desired, add ½ cup (120ml) of cold water to the chilled coffee to adjust the strength to your preference.
- In a tall glass or pitcher, combine the chilled coffee, milk, sweetener, cinnamon, and vanilla extract.
- Stir well to ensure all ingredients are thoroughly mixed.
- Fill the glass with ice cubes.
- Enjoy your refreshing low-calorie iced cafe au lait immediately!
